Unit 'nxModel' Package
[Overview][Types][Classes][Index] [#pl_nxpascal]

TTriModel

[Properties (by Name)] [Methods (by Name)] [Events (by Name)]

Declaration

Source position: nxModel.pas line 85

type TTriModel = class(T3DModel)

  frames: Integer;

  

  fa: array of TTriFaceIndices;

  

  frame: array of TVertexFrame;

  

public

  property fCount: LongInt; [rw]

  

  constructor Create(); overload;

  

  constructor CreateCube();

  

  constructor CreatePlane();

  

  constructor CreateSphere();

  

  constructor CreateTorus();

  

  function AddFace();

  

  procedure AssignTo();

  

  procedure Clear;

  

  procedure DoTextureCorrection;

  

  function FindNearest();

  

  procedure FlipFaces;

  

  function GetTangent();

  

  procedure LoadFromFile();

  

  procedure LoadFromMS3D();

  

  procedure LoadFromOBJ();

  

  procedure LoadFromW3D();

  

  procedure MakeNormals;

  

  function rayIntersect();

  

  procedure RotateUV(); overload;

  

  procedure ScaleUV(); overload;

  

  procedure SaveToFile();

  

  procedure TranslateUV(); overload;

  

end;

Inheritance

TTriModel

  

|

T3DModel

  

|

TObject



CT Web help

CodeTyphon Studio